    Jabiru protection was the Belize Audubon Society's first advocacy project. In 1973 the Jabiru was added to Belize's list of protected animals. Crooked Tree Wildlife Sanctuary, the first Wildlife Sanctuary declared by the Government of Belize, was gazetted on December 8, 1984. [3]

    It operates wholly within Belize under license and support from the Government of Belize Forest Department. The main focus of the organisation is the rehabilitation for release of wild-caught psittacines (parrots) liberated from the illegal local pet trade. As of July 2017, Belize Bird Rescue has returned almost 1000 ex-captive parrots to the wild.

    Bird Island, March 2010. Bird Island is a cay and bird sanctuary located near Tobacco Caye in the western Caribbean. The island is home to frigatebirds and red-footed boobies and tourists are not allowed to dock or set foot on it. In 2001, a hurricane destroyed the mangrove forest on the island, yet birds continued to roost.

    The early stages of bird conservation in Belize are attributed to the Belize Audubon Society, whose first conservation project was the jabiru, added to Belize's list of protected species in 1973. [16] In 1977, the government established seven bird sanctuaries for the protection of waterfowl nesting and roosting colonies.

    The Aguacaliente Wildlife Sanctuary is a nature reserve in the Toledo District of southern Belize. It encompasses approximately 5,492 acres (22.23 km 2 ) and was declared a sanctuary in 1998. The Sanctuary is critical for the preservation of biodiversity in Belize and the region. [ 1 ]
